The Joy of Children's Motorbikes A Perfect Blend of Fun and Safety


Children's motorbikes have become increasingly popular in recent years, captivating young riders and their families. These specially designed bikes offer a thrilling experience, combining the excitement of riding with essential safety features tailored to the needs of kids. The growth in this market reflects a broader trend of introducing children to healthy outdoor activities that promote physical coordination, confidence, and responsibility.

Safety, undoubtedly, is a primary concern for parents when it comes to children's motorbikes. Thankfully, modern motorbikes come equipped with a range of safety features designed to protect young riders. These include speed limiters, which help maintain a safe pace, as well as sturdy frames and adjustable seat heights to ensure a proper fit as children grow. Furthermore, many children's motorbikes incorporate electric power systems, which are environmentally friendly and often quieter than traditional gas-powered models. Electric bikes also typically have lower speeds, reducing the risk of accidents during the learning phase.

Before a child can hit the road, it is crucial to provide them with adequate training and equipment. Enrolling them in a motorcycle safety course can help instill essential riding skills and safe habits early on. Wearing appropriate safety gear, including helmets, knee pads, and elbow pads, is also non-negotiable. This protective gear greatly reduces the chance of injury and fosters a culture of safety and responsibility among young riders.


The social aspect of riding a children's motorbike should not be overlooked. Many kids enjoy riding together, experiencing the joy of camaraderie that comes from shared adventures. Family outings, community rides, or local motorcycle clubs can be a great way to bond and create lasting memories. These experiences not only enrich a child’s life but also teach them about teamwork, respect for others, and the importance of following rules—lessons that extend far beyond the realm of riding.


In addition to recreational benefits, children who ride motorbikes can also develop a sense of responsibility. Owning a motorbike requires maintenance, such as checking tire pressure, cleaning, and occasional repairs. By taking care of their bike, children learn valuable life skills and the importance of personal accountability.
